Life of an Architect Podcast Ep. 120: Ask the Show – Spring 2023 Edition

Life of an Architect Podcast

Life of an Architect Podcast Ep. 120: Ask the Show – Spring 2023 Edition


By Bob Borson, FAIA | March 6, 2023

What are the top three deficiencies of the architectural profession? What is your best non-architecture source for creative inspiration? How does an architect deal with burnout? These questions (and more!) answered by Life of an Architect co-hosts Bob Borson, FAIA, and Andrew Hawkins, AIA, in Episode 120: Ask the Show – Spring 2023 Edition.
